Alberto Milone (albertomilone) wrote : Re: Unable to install Broadcom STA wireless dirver on 3.8 / 3.11 kernel via jockey-gtk

Ok, now that we have confirmed that that's the issue, please follow these steps:

1) Uninstall the broadcom driver

2) dowgrade jockey to 0.9.7-0ubuntu7.15

3) Reboot

4) Make sure jockey-backend is not running ("ps aux | grep jockey-backend"). If it is, make sure to kill it.

5) Type the following command:
sudo strace -fvvs1024 -o /tmp/jockey.trace /usr/share/jockey/jockey-backend --debug

6) Launch jockey as usual and try to install the driver so as to reproduce the problem

7) Attach the /tmp/jockey.trace file
